Datastage Designer Resume Profile
2.00/5 (Submit Your Rating)
EXPERIENCE SUMMARY:
- 9 Years of overall IT experience in Data warehousing Applications design, Development, Testing and Project Management, With 7 years of Experience in ETL Development and Design using IBM Websphere Datastage8.1 Enterprise and other previous Ascential Datastage versions and 2 years in Oracle ETL development.
- Expertise in Ascential Datastage 7.5.2 Server Edition as well.
- Expertise in Datastage issue resolution, debugging and application performance tuning.
- Expertise in Performance tuning of Datastage jobs
- Expertise in extracting data from various versions of Oracle and Teradata Database using Datastage.
- Expertise in Oracle SQL, PLSQL coding.
- Proficient in UNIX korn Shell Scripting.
- Familiar with PERL scripts.
- Familiar with BASIC Batch jobs development in Datastage.
- Familiar with Pentaho ETL Tool haven't implemented any projects
- Familiar with BTEQ, Fast load, Fast export concepts in Teradata.
- Expertise in performance tuning by using Explain Plan, Creating appropriate indexes, queries optimization, utilizing table spaces, partitioning schemes in oracle.
- Experience in creating project design documents High Level Design Document, Software Requirement Specification, Mid Level Platform Application design Document MLPD , Detailed Platform Application Design Document DPAD .
- Expertise in developing and maintaining overall Test Methodology and Strategy, Documenting Test Plans, Test Cases and editing, executing Test Cases and Test Scripts.
- Resolving data issues, complete unit testing and complete system documentation for ETL processes
- Involved in development of Test cases, executing the Unit/UAT Test cases.
- Involved extensively in Unit Testing, System Testing and Regression Testing.
- Experience on Defect tracking tools like HP Quality Center.
- Involved in daily interactions with the Business to understand their requirements and act in a Business Liaison role.
- Setting up Defect calls for tracking and closing the defects.
- Experience in producing project estimation, timeline scheduling, resource forecasting, communicating key milestones to IT management and clients, Task scheduling and status tracking.
- Excellent communication skills, problem solving skills, Leadership qualities and an attitude to learn the new cutting edge technologies.
- Experience in leading and mentoring team members on both functional and technical aspects.
- Flexible, enthusiastic and project oriented team player with solid communication and leadership skills to develop creative solution for challenging client needs.
- Able to work independently and collaborate proactively cross functionally within a team.
Technical Skills:
|
|
|
|
|
|
|
|
|
|
|
|
PROFESSIONAL EXPERIENCE:
Confidential
Role: Datastage Consultant.
Responsibilities
- Design and Development of ETL jobs using Datastage 8.1 Enterprise Edition and Server Edition as well.
- Preparing Software Requirement Specification SRS , Code review document, Test Case Specification and Deployment plan Documents
- Done, Full project design for FedEx Tax Services system, which includes preparing Software Requirement Specification document, interacting with source teams and preparing mapping documents, Datastage Coding, Unit Testing, support during system testing, preparing deployment plan, supporting business objects reporting team for their testing and supporting business during their UAT.
- Done Development enhancements for the work request received for FedEx ECOM, Mobile print, Online Signs and Graphics, packaging and shipping projects which included extracting data using Datastage from Oracle Database and Enterprise Data Warehouse Teradata Database, transforming them and loading into Oracle database which was used by the Business objects team for their reporting, The work involved in these projects include, Preparing SRS, Identifying source systems and preparing Mapping documents, documenting and presenting reject handling techniques to business, preparing code review document and deployment plan.
- Created Reject handling shared container for FedEx ECOM project which was used for reporting issues in various source system files received from the upstream systems.
- Created common jobs in Datastage Server Edition using CRC for Change Data Capture and producing Insert, update load ready files and delete files for loading in the target tables.
- Created SFTP Unix script Datastage jobs to support the HR source system which was upgraded to PeopleSoft 9.1
- Produced Impact analysis documents, followed by SRS, Code review, Datastage Coding changes and other project documents to support decommissioning of the Central Repository CR DB and replacing with Enterprise Database EDB
- Supported business enhancements for Business objects requirements which required code changes in Datastage for work requests like Coupon code applied, Customer Base foundation CBF , etc
- Done BASIC code development and job changes for implementing batch jobs for Order analysis project and an ETL Modernization decommissioning work request.
- Created documentation for a large ETL application which was having no documentation at all previously and facing various issues in production and kept receiving various change request, the documentation has been widely appreciated for its usefulness and the precise information helped both the business and other downstream systems.
- Other responsibilities include Fixing Production defects, doing system testing and system integration testing for Datastage coding done by other developers
- Provided various inputs for creating Data warehouse standard Document
Confidential
Role: Datastage Designer / Lead Developer.
Responsibilities:
- During my tenure in Lloyds as Datastage Designer and Lead developer I have predominantly worked in Datastage modules of the projects related to Financial Data processing, Business Performance Management, Sales Marketing Analysis and Reporting, e-Statements which has extensive usage of Datastage 8.1.
- Participated in all phases of project cycle including Requirement Analysis, Client Interaction, Design, Coding, Testing, Production support and Documentation.
- Involved in gathering business requirements and providing development and testing estimation, timelines and resource forecasting.
- Responsible for preparing Mid Level Platform Application Design MLPD and Detailed Platform Application Design DPAD Documents based on Business Requirement specification document, giving walkthrough to Document review panel members, clients and obtaining sign offs from the CIO and other Subject Matter Experts from the Client Organization before proceeding with the build activity.
- Involved in preparing the coding standards documentation for Datastage Development.
- Involved in designing complex Parallel Datastage jobs, sequencers.
- Involved in working with SAP Ledger downstream systems by sending SAP reference files and loading processed data to the SAP tables.
- Extensively used Job Stages like Datasets, Sequential file, Lookup, Aggregator, Join, Transformer, Sort, Funnel, Remove Duplicates, Merge, Filter, SCD, Change capture, Copy, External filter, External Source, Pivot, Complex Flat File Stages, etc
- Used Datastage XML input stage for processing banks hierarchical files
- Coordinated with UNIX admin and service delivery team in procuring the UNIX environment and to create Datastage UNIX environment file system and directories.
- Involved in extracting the data from various sources like Flat files, Oracle and Teradata databases.
- Familiar with BTEQ, Fast load, Fast export concepts in Teradata.
- Involved in developing Key Data validation and splitting modules using Datastage in Financial Data processing project for various sources files coming from different source systems.
- Used multiple invocation techniques for running jobs in various instances so as to reduce the time and expediting the processes.
- Used Datastage Designer to develop jobs for extracting, cleansing, transforming, integrating, and loading data into data warehouse database.
- Utilized slowly changing Dimensions for tracking changes to dimensions over time
- Used Data stage Administrator for defining environment variables and project level settings.
- Utilized the stages of Job Sequence such as User Variable Activity, Notification Activity, Routine Activity, Terminator Activity, etc.
- Involved in developing error logging shared containers and extensively used in various Datastage jobs to gather the error logs in a business defined format, which facilitated the business in analyzing the erroneous files and fixing them quickly.
- Responsible for validating the Datastage jobs, sequencers against the pre-defined ETL design standards.
- Involved in developing Connect direct jobs for transferring files to the downstream systems and for pulling files from the source systems as well.
- Involved in Datastage jobs bug fixing and supporting testing team during various stages of testing.
- Involved in tuning Source extract SQL scripts used in ETL jobs to meet the business SLAs.
- Analyzed the requirements to identify the necessary tables that need to be populated into the staging database.
- Prepared the DDL's for the staging/work tables and coordinated with DBA for creating the development environment.
- Developed Ksh shell scripts for automating Datastage jobs and Housekeeping activities.
- Created Shell Scripts to automatically notify Business Exceptions and Rejects during the Loads and file processing stages.
- Created Unix Shell Scripts to read the Parameter Files and passing these values to the job during runtime.
- Experience in preparing and reviewing Functional Test Plans and Master Test Plans for various stages of the testing activities
- Responsible for preparing various test scenarios and validating the data as per the business rules.
- Involved in preparing and executing System Testing and System Integration test cases
- Provided support during User Acceptance Testing by running jobs and providing fixes.
- Co-ordinate the offshore development, testing and implementations using implementation plans.
- Responsible for doing the peer reviews, Planning and estimating the project requirements and to report the status to business managers.
Confidential
Role: Datastage Developer/Designer.
Responsibilities:
- Involved in Gathering Business Requirement and producing inputs to MLPD and DPAD.
- Involved in all phases of project cycle including Requirement Analysis, Client Interaction, Design, Coding, Testing, support and Documentation.
- Responsible for preparing ETL Documentation for the developed processes.
- Investigation of possible Terrorist/Money laundering transactions happening in the system for the tickets raised by the business
- Responsible for handling Production Support tickets.
- Automated SQL queries using UNIX scripts for loading large volume of data during data migration activities in AML Project
- Involved in tuning many Oracle scripts and other ETL processes used in this project.
- Responsible for doing the peer reviews, Planning and estimating the project requirements and to report the status to business managers.
- Created Documentation for the developed jobs where appropriate documents were not available.
- Provided production support and bug fixing during various stages of the testing
- Involved in Designing and Developing of Datastage Parallel Jobs, Sequencers and Shared Containers
- Performance Tuning of Datastage jobs and Oracle SQL queries.
- Extensively used Job Stages like Datasets, Sequential file, Lookup, Aggregator, Join, Transformer, Sort, Funnel, Remove Duplicates, Merge, Filter, SCD, Change capture, Copy, External filter, External Source, Pivot, etc.
- Used multiple invocation technique for running jobs in multiple instances to speed up the process.
- Involved in writing oracle PLSQL Stored Procedures, SQL scripts
- Developed Ksh shell scripts for automating Datastage jobs and Housekeeping activities.
- Created Shell Scripts to automatically notify Business Exceptions and Rejects during the Loads and file processing stages.
- Created Unix Shell Scripts to read the Parameter Files and passing these values to the job during runtime.
- Responsible for preparing Unit test cases and validating the data as per the business rules.
- Provided support to the testing team during System Testing , System Integration Testing and User Acceptance testing
Confidential
Role: ETL Oracle Developer.
Responsibilities:
- Understanding Business Requirements
- Developing Datastage jobs using the MLPD, DPAD and Business Requirement Specification document.
- Extensively used Job Stages like Datasets, Sequential file, Lookup, Aggregator, Join, Transformer, Sort, Funnel, Remove Duplicates, Merge, Filter, Change capture, Copy, External filter, External Source, Pivot, etc.
- Developing Oracle SQL, PL/SQL queries and DDL's for the Database creation.
- Performance tuning of SQL Queries.
- Developing UNIX scripts for automating Datastage jobs.
- Extensively used Datastage Designer Director.
- Writing and executing test case for unit testing
- Providing support to QA team during System Testing and System Integration Testing.
- Coordinating with UNIX Admin and DBA's for Datastage UNIX environment creation and Database creation
- Engaged in Production Support tasks.
- Documenting the changes for future reference.